Kornati Diving Center in Zaglav and other island operators use day boats to connect local training reefs, the outer Dugi Otok coast, and regulated Telascica sites. The park's standout dives are limestone walls with red gorgonians, holes, small caves, Posidonia, and a broad Adriatic fish community. Sestrica Mala offers a funnel-like wall, Korotan adds a small cave and a drop toward 35 m, while the Garmenjak sites combine ledges, caverns, and deeper terrain. Beyond the park, Golubinka Cave, Brbinjscica, and operator-listed wreck trips broaden a week. This is not an independent shore-diving destination. Boats, permits, weather, and the center's daily site decision structure the experience.

Operator Checklist
Book Telascica dives through an authorized club or center and ask whether the quoted rate includes the park visitor ticket, boat supplement, cylinders, weights, gas, and equipment. The official park tariff retrieved in September 2026 is still labeled 2025, so reconfirm all fees. Reserve nitrox, stages, rebreather consumables, or uncommon sizes before reaching the island. Keep at least one weather-reserve day, especially for outer-coast caves or wrecks. The skipper and park rules control the final site, and conservation closures or rough water take priority over a wish list.
